If there is a place that represents the wild nature of the Costa da Morte, it is the route that goes from Cabo Vilán to Monte Branco. A practically virgin place with stunning nature. We consider that any of the beaches on this route can be fantastic on a night with clear skies, but from the beach of A Balea or from Reira you will have one of the best views of the iconic Vilán lighthouse.

Can you imagine a starry night with the sea breaking strong and the Vilán as a backdrop? Well, you can now reserve a space in your summer agenda for this unique plan.
